What is a Gold Individual Retirement Account?

A Gold IRA is actually a kind of IRA technically called a self-directed IRA. Many people additionally call it a precious metals IRA.
It is very similar to a standard IRA because you still have the same withdrawal policies as well as contribution limits. The difference is found with the type of assets that it can hold such as IRS-approved physical gold in the form of specific kinds of coins as well as bullion.

Particular kinds of platinum, silver and palladium are likewise eligible for this sort of IRA.

The Internal Revenue Service guidelines additionally specify that the gold and silver in a self-directed IRA are required to be kept in a 3rd party IRS-approved center.

How Do I Open a Gold IRA?

The initial step to setting up a precious metals IRA is to select a gold IRA investment business that has experience and also specializes in these types of accounts.

This consists of the opening of your account, moving your funds, purchasing the appropriate metals as well as making sure that your physical gold and silver are held in an IRS-approved vault for storing.

Financing Your Account

When your account is established, you will certainly be required to fund it in generally one of 3 ways:

1. You can write a check, wire transfer or use cash to fund your account.

2. With a rollover from your Individual Retirement Account, 401(k), 403(b) or a similar qualified account.

3. Transfer funds directly from your existing IRA to your gold IRA.

Choose Your Precious Metals

When your account is funded, you can select the eligible gold, silver, platinum or palladium to invest in your gold IRA.

With help from a precious metals professional from your selected gold IRA company, you will definitely be given advice regarding what kind of physical gold and other precious metals to buy based on the Internal Revenue Service guidelines.

Disadvantages of a Gold IRA

Restrictions on financing. If you currently possess physical gold and silver, you are not allowed to move them to a precious metals IRA. Additionally, you can’t personally get precious metals and send them to your Gold IRA. All precious metal purchases need to be made by a custodian acting in your interest for the precious metals IRA.

No tax-free growth of earnings. Because physical gold, silver, platinum and palladium does not pay dividends or interest there is no revenue being made to make use of the tax-free growth element of buying an Individual Retirement Account.
